首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

jQuery在复选框处于活动状态时禁用其他行中的输入

jQuery是一种流行的JavaScript库,用于简化HTML文档遍历、事件处理、动画效果等操作。它提供了丰富的API,使得前端开发更加便捷和高效。

在复选框处于活动状态时禁用其他行中的输入,可以通过以下步骤实现:

  1. 首先,使用jQuery选择器选取所有的复选框元素。例如,可以使用类选择器选取所有具有特定类名的复选框:$('.checkbox')
  2. 接下来,使用jQuery的事件处理函数来监听复选框的状态变化。可以使用change()函数来监听复选框的改变事件。
  3. 在事件处理函数中,可以使用jQuery的遍历函数来遍历其他行中的输入元素,并根据复选框的状态来禁用或启用这些输入元素。例如,可以使用each()函数来遍历其他行中的输入元素,并使用prop('disabled', true)来禁用这些输入元素。

下面是一个示例代码:

代码语言:javascript
复制
$('.checkbox').change(function() {
  var isChecked = $(this).is(':checked');
  if (isChecked) {
    $(this).closest('tr').siblings().find('input').prop('disabled', true);
  } else {
    $(this).closest('tr').siblings().find('input').prop('disabled', false);
  }
});

在这个示例代码中,我们首先监听了所有具有.checkbox类的复选框的改变事件。当复选框的状态发生改变时,我们获取其是否被选中的状态,并根据这个状态来禁用或启用其他行中的输入元素。

这个方法适用于需要在复选框处于活动状态时禁用其他行中的输入的场景,例如表格中的多选功能或者需要控制输入的交互界面。腾讯云提供了丰富的云计算产品,如云服务器、云数据库、云存储等,可以根据具体需求选择适合的产品进行开发和部署。

更多关于jQuery的信息和使用方法,可以参考腾讯云的官方文档:jQuery官方文档

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

当iOS遇见UI

典型被动控件就是文本框,这些文本框可用于接受用户输入,但它们不会激发任何方法。 iOS应用,UI控件所属角色并不是一成不变,有些控件可根据开发人员需求选择多种模式运行。...当然,像UIButton之类按钮控件,除了活动模式下激发方法之外,它并没有太多其他功能。...,并且它们在任意时刻总处于且只能处于以下状态之一。...普通:普通状态是所有控件默认状态。 高亮:当UI控件需要突出显示,它处于高亮状态。对按钮来说,当用户手指放在按钮上,它才处于高亮状态禁用:当UI控件被关闭,它处于禁用状态。...禁用状态UI控件是不可操作,如果要禁用某个控件,则可以Interface Builder取消选中Enabled复选框,或将控件enabled属性设为NO。

74610
  • 认识基本mfc控件

    复选框控件:复选框是一个方框,用户可以通过单击来选中或者不选中。复选框用来打开或者关闭某一个特定值,除了基本打开和关闭开关外,还有第三种状态,一种中间态。   ...用来一次一组两个或者更多只选出一个值处于打开状态。 ? 这个就是单选按钮控件。   组合框控件:也叫下拉列表框。控件是一个带有可用值列表编辑框。...使用组合框提供一系列选择,用户可以从中选取一个值。有时用户可以提供列表满足要求直接输入一个值。   每个控件都有属性,用来对这个控件进行说明。下面列出基本属性,每个控件框都有的。...ID:标识控件,改变ID属性以便识别并且与其他控件互动 Caption:指明显示控件上文本 Visible:表明程序运行时控件是否可见 Disanled:表明是否禁用控件。...如果禁用会让Caption文本只显示轮廓或者像是对话框表面上凹痕。 Tab Stop:表明当用户使用tab键在对话框中移动,这个控件是否被选中。

    3.4K20

    Chrome设置断点各种姿势

    当断点触发,整个页面会处于暂停状态,并会切换到Source页签断点处方便调试,直到终止该断点调试后页面才会继续运行。 设置断点行号上会显示一个蓝色矩形来告诉你这里有一个断点。 P.S....当一个表达式跨行时,添加断点会默认下移到该表达式结束后 ? JavaScript代码设置条件断点 当知道了如何在行号上单击来添加断点,已经能满足最最最基本调试了。...这是我们会看到界面上多出了一个输入框,并提示我们将在XXX设置一个只会满足下列表达式时候才会暂停断点-.- ?...点击断点对应复选框可以禁用断点,右键选择Remove breakpoint也可删除断点。 以及一些对断点其他操作也可以通过右键菜单来实现,禁用激活所有的断点之类。 ?...就是勾选复选框即可,当触发某个事件,便会跳转到对应代码中去。 截图展开部分就是XHR请求周期各种状态事件 ?

    15.3K80

    【原创】bootstrap框架学习 第八课 -

    使用内联表单,您需要在表单控件上设置一个宽度。 使用 class .sr-only,您可以隐藏内联表单标签。 效果图: ?...表单控件状态 除了 :focus 状态(即,用户点击 input 或使用 tab 键聚焦到 input 上),Bootstrap 还为禁用输入框定义了样式,并提供了表单验证 class。...输入框焦点 当输入框 input 接收到 :focus 输入轮廓会被移除,同时应用 box-shadow。...禁用输入框 input 如果您想要禁用一个输入框 input,只需要简单地添加 disabled 属性,这不仅会禁用输入框,还会改变输入样式以及当鼠标的指针悬停在元素上鼠标指针样式。...禁用字段集 fieldset 对 添加 disabled 属性来禁用所有控件。 验证状态 Bootstrap 包含了错误、警告和成功消息验证样式。

    1.3K20

    Bootstrap响应式前端框架笔记四——表单

    Bootstrap响应式前端框架笔记四——表单 一、基本表单样式     Bootstrap框架,可以为表单标签添加form-control属性来为其设置默认样式,默认表单控件宽度将充满父容器标签...需要注意,布局表单,可以为其设置一个label标签用于说明,将label标签for属性与表单标签id相对应,可以实现当用户点击label标签使其对应表单自动获取输入焦点。.../>被禁用复选框 效果如下: ?    ...如果在开发需要使一组表单元素全部处于禁用状态,可以使用fieldset标签进行包裹,并为fieldset标签添加disabled属性。...Bootstrap也定义好了一些校验状态样式,例如警告,成功,错误等状态,为表单元素父标签添加这些状态类即可,示例如下: 校验状态 <div class=

    2.2K10

    【BootStrap】栅格系统、表单样式与按钮样式-附有源码

    ##嵌套列 列嵌套:就是某个栏,再嵌套一个完整栅格系统。....form-inline内联表单样式(用于form元素):可以使元素一排列。 .checkbox复选框样式 .radio单选框样式 .disabled可以禁用单选框或复选项文本。....checkbox-inline 控制多个复选框元素同一显示。 .radio-inline控制多个单选框元素同一显示。 ##添加额外图标 你还可以针对校验状态输入框添加额外图标。...##激活状态 当按钮处于激活状态,其表现为被按压下去(底色更深、边框夜色更深、向内投射阴影)。对于 元素,是通过 :active 状态实现。...##禁用状态 为 元素添加 disabled 属性,使其表现出禁用状态

    1.3K10

    前端基础知识总结

    jquery对象转dom对象 语法:从数组获得第一个对象,第一个对象就是dom对象,使用[0]或者get(0) 为什么要进行dom和jQuery转换 目的是要使用对象方法或者属性 当dom对象...,可以使用dom对象属性或者方法,要想使用jQuery提供函数,必须要是jQuery对象才 命名建议:命名jQuery对象,为了与dom对象区分,习惯以$开头(建议) 示例: function...element UI布局组件将页面划分为多个row,每行最多分为24栏(列) bootstrap每行最多12栏 el-row和el-col 和列 一个布局是由和列组成,row属性和col...active-color="#13ce66" 默认选中颜色,激活颜色 inactive-color="red" 点一下,关闭后颜色 active-text="打开" 打开状态文字...明亮和黑暗 Alert 组件,你可以设置是否可关闭,关闭按钮文本以及关闭回调函数。closable属性决定是否可关闭,接受boolean,默认为true。

    1.2K50

    【iOS 开发】基本 UI 控件详解 (UIButton | UITextField | UITextView | UISwitch)

    UI 控件分类 UI 控件分类 : 活动控件, 被动控件, 静态控件; -- 活动控件 : 继承了 UIControl 基类, 该类控件可以与用户交互, 对应操作会激发对应 事件绑定回调方法, 之前...普通 : UI 控件默认状态; -- 高亮 : UI 控件突出显示, 处于高亮状态; 手放在按钮上处于高亮状态; -- 禁用 : UI 控件关闭后, 处于禁用状态; 禁用状态控件不可操作, 禁用操作...Interface Builder 取消 Enable 复选框; -- 选中 : 用于标识控件已启用 或 被选中, 选中状态可以不断持续, 高亮状态 按下才显示; (4) UI 控件状态 UI...文本, 图片, 格式; -- Default : 默认状态; -- Highlighted : 用户碰触高亮状态; -- Selected : 被选中状态; -- Disabled : 禁用状态...框默认禁用, 输入文本后可用, 用于强制用户必须输入内容; -- Secure : 勾选后, 输入内容以黑点显示, 用于输入密码; 2.

    6.8K20

    Bootstrap 表单

    使用内联表单,您需要在表单控件上设置一个宽度。 使用 class .sr-only,您可以隐藏内联表单标签。 水平表单 水平表单与其他表单不仅标记数量上不同,而且表单呈现形式也不同。...必要可以改变 rows 属性(较少 = 较小盒子,较多 = 较大盒子)。...对一系列复选框和单选框使用 .checkbox-inline 或 .radio-inline class,控制它们显示同一上。...禁用输入框 input 如果您想要禁用一个输入框 input,只需要简单地添加 disabled 属性,这不仅会禁用输入框,还会改变输入样式以及当鼠标的指针悬停在元素上鼠标指针样式。...本实例帮助文本总共有两。 结果如下所示:

    1.9K20

    CSS 基础系列:伪类和伪元素

    2.伪类和伪元素概念 2.1 伪类: 伪类用于当已有元素处于某个状态,为其添加对应样式,这个状态是根据用户行为而动态变化。...与用户交互过程中元素状态是动态变化,因此该元素会根据其状态呈现不同样式。当元素处于状态时会呈现该样式,而进入另一状态后,该样式就会失去。状态伪类顺序很重要,顺序错误可能会导致没有效果。...当某组单选框或复选框还没有选取状态,:indeterminate 匹配该组中所有的单选框或复选框。...实际上,lang=” “ 属性不只可以 html 标签上设置,也可以在其他元素上设置。 :dir 匹配指定阅读方向元素。 当 HTML 元素设置了 dir 属性该伪类才能生效。...匹配元素第一文本 这个伪元素只能用在块元素,不能用在内联元素 4.1 仅双冒号 选择器 示例 示例说明 ::selection 匹配被用户选中或者处于高亮状态部分 FF浏览器使用时需要添加

    1.9K10

    6 个新功能、39 个增强功能!JupyterLab 新版本更新!

    建议可以输入时调用,也可以使用可配置快捷键(默认为 Alt + \)手动调用。当鼠标悬停在幽灵建议上,默认键盘快捷键会显示小部件。...要启用执行历史,请进入 "设置编辑器"→"笔记本"→选中 "内核历史访问 "复选框以前版本,该功能已在控制台中提供;它只适用于支持执行历史请求内核。...当文件位于Jupyter根目录,这些链接会打开相应文件以进行编辑;如果文件根目录之外,且当前内核支持调试器,这些链接将以只读模式打开预览。...目录错误指示符 当单元格执行过程中出现故障,相应标题会显示一个错误指示符,以提高对笔记本状态认识,并使用户能够快速导航到需要注意单元格。...插件管理器本身可以使用 CLI 禁用。 窗口模式虚拟滚动条 窗口笔记本现在有一个可选滚动条,可显示活动单元格和选定单元格。用户可以跳转到特定单元格。

    82810

    Pywinauto之Windows UI自动化4

    () 5、关闭窗口 dlg.close() 三、窗口控件分类 状态栏:StatusBar 静态内容:Static 按钮:Button 复选框:CheckBox...:等待窗口不处于某个特定状态参数; wait_for :等待状态(状态有以下几种) exists:表示该窗口是有效句柄 visible:表示该窗口未隐藏 enabled...:表示未禁用窗口- ready:表示该窗口可见并启用· active:表示该窗口处于活动状态 timeout :超时时间 retry _interval :重试时间间隔 2、Wait_not...方法: 作用:等待窗口不处于某个特定状态参数; wait_for :等待状态(状态有以下几种) exists:表示该窗口是有效句柄 visible:表示该窗口未隐藏 enabled...:表示未禁用窗口- ready:表示该窗口可见并启用· active:表示该窗口处于活动状态 timeout :超时时间 retry _interval :重试时间间隔 3、wait_cpu_usage_lower

    3.8K20

    【Java 进阶篇】JQuery 案例:全选全不选,为选择添彩

    使用 JQuery 选择器选中需要进行全选和全不选操作目标元素,通常是表格多个复选框。 为触发元素绑定事件,监听其点击事件。...事件处理函数,通过 JQuery 选择器选中目标元素,并设置它们 checked 属性,实现全选和全不选效果。 下面是一个基本实现示例: <!...然后,通过为这两类元素分别绑定点击事件处理函数,函数根据点击元素状态设置目标元素状态,从而实现全选和全不选效果。...我们通过on()方法将点击事件委托给ul元素,然后点击事件发生,判断点击是哪个子元素li input[type='checkbox'],并执行相应操作。...增加用户提示 全选全不选功能生效,可以给用户一些提示,告诉他们当前选择状态。例如,全选按钮上添加一个文字提示,显示当前状态

    34840

    【译】W3C WAI-ARIA最佳实践 -- 布局

    grid 模式使用大致可分为两类:展示表格信息(数据表格)和集合其他部件(布局栅格)。尽管数据网格和布局栅格使用相同ARIA角色、状态和属性,它们内容和目的不同是考虑键盘交互设计重要因素。...如果网格包含带有用于选择复选框列,则该键可以用作焦点不在复选框勾选框快捷方式。 Control + A: 选择所有单元格。...Shift + Space: 选择包含焦点。如果网格包含用于选择复选框列,当焦点不在复选框,可作为选中复选框快捷键。 Control + A: 选择所有单元格。...Enter: 禁用网格导航以及: 如果单元格包含可编辑内容,将焦点放置输入,例如 textbox。...字母数字键: 如果单元格包含可编辑内容,则会将焦点放在输入,例如 textbox。 当网格导航被禁用时,导航行为常规更改包括: Escape: 恢复网格导航。

    6.2K50

    【Web APIs】JavaScript 操作元素 ③ ( 修改表单元素属性 | 表单常用属性 | 表单常用属性修改示例 )

    密码字段 单选按钮 复选框 下拉列表 文件选择框 这些输入元素允许用户输入数据 , 然后可以将这些数据提交到服务器进行处理 ; 2、表单常用属性 HTML 表单元素比较特殊 , 有很多属性和样式需要特殊处理...; 如 : input 输入框 表单 内容 , 不能使用 innerHTML 进行修改 , 必须通过 input 表单 value 属性修改输入值 ; 表单 中最常用属性如下所示 : type...: 定义输入元素类型 , 如 : text、password、checkbox、radio、submit 等 ; name : 定义输入元素名称 , 用于提交表单标识数据 ; <input..., 禁用元素表单提交不会包含在提交数据 ; 3、表单常用属性修改示例 代码示例 : <!...this.disabled = "true"; } 执行结果 : 页面刷新后 , 处于初始状态 , 按钮可点击 , 表单显示内容是

    8710
    领券